Transaction 8585399286e12016d101a91255ccffd4470f004bf2201d3b6fde878005d18779

1 Input
2 Outputs
  • 8585399286e12016d101a91255ccffd4470f004bf2201d3b6fde878005d18779:0
  • value  324160
    address  bc1qpewmqeem2qmt9l5hl95cfym0rrwd5z7seufl6q
  • 8585399286e12016d101a91255ccffd4470f004bf2201d3b6fde878005d18779:1
  • value  2068848
    address  14QF6kyGA4gNK6YTbCkGvfsUG7YKRqnE3T